Hamilton Park Nursing and Rehabilitation Center
691 92nd Street Brooklyn, NY 11228
Hamilton Park Nursing and Rehabilitation Center is dedicated to creating a patient-centered care environment where our focus is on you. Our unique 365 Advantage program combines a boutique-style living environment with cutting-edge technologies and world-class physicians, nurses and therapists, all designed to speed your recovery and get you back to living the life you love. We offer short-term rehabilitation, long-term care, skilled nursing, and hospice care for those living in Brooklyn and throughout New York City.
